为了账号安全,请及时绑定邮箱和手机立即绑定

一台电脑上是不是可以运行很多服务器。只要监听不同端口就OK

我mac上跑着阿帕奇服务器,通过127.0.0.1:80可以访问到我阿帕奇服务器,服务目录下到文件。 现在装了node.js按照老师说到步骤,我可以通过127.0.0.1:1377访问另一个服务器。。显示holle motherFucker。这里我就有点迷了。通过同一个ip到不同端口可以访问到不同服务器提供到服务。服务器是通过端口来提供服务到吗?可能我语言表述不准确。按照这个意思来说的话,我可以再写一个server2.js文件。监听8888端口,通过访问127.0.0.1:8888返回i love you在浏览器上,对吧?实测可以。哪位老哥可以给我一个学术一点的解释。

正在回答

3 回答

阿帕奇我没有试,nodejs我试了,可以监听不同端口

0 回复 有任何疑惑可以回复我~

一个apache好像只能监听一个端口,假如要在同一台机器上运行两个站点,好像是要安装两个apache的。虚拟主机好像也能实现

0 回复 有任何疑惑可以回复我~
#1

Jagen

apache 可以监听多个不同端口的
2018-11-25 回复 有任何疑惑可以回复我~

是的呀,你说的完全正确。你可以同时在多个端口启动服务器,前提是端口没有被占用

0 回复 有任何疑惑可以回复我~
#1

阿兰尹花 提问者

好像是这样的,我先用node.js在521端口启动一个服务,但是会报错。尝试了几下也不行,然后我就改了端口号,于是用node.js成功启动了两个服务。现实中等使用场景也是这样的吗?一个物理电脑上有多个服务器程序在运行提供服务?
2018-05-14 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
进击Node.js基础(一)
  • 参与学习       219397    人
  • 解答问题       896    个

本视频教程带你揭开Node.js的面纱,带你走进一个全新世界

进入课程

一台电脑上是不是可以运行很多服务器。只要监听不同端口就OK

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信